  2. 3. Installing Viber

    Installing Viber for CentOS
    So first, Access the Target Directory:

    cd && cd Downloads

    To Verify it’s there List the Directory Contents with:

    ls . | grep viber

    The grep Command Refine the output List showing only the entries Matching the Keyword.
    But when Downloaded with Firefox it may be instead into the /tmp/mozilla* Folder…
    Finally, to Install Viber:

    sudo yum install ./viber.rpm
  3. 4. Installing Dependencies

    Again Install Required Libraries
    Simply with:

    sudo yum install xcb-util*

    On Desktop if Not Launching then Fix Viber App Launcher:

    sudo nano /usr/share/applications/viber.desktop

    If Got “User is Not in Sudoers file” then see: How to Enable sudo
    Change the Exec & Path as:

    Exec=/opt/viber/Viber %u
    

    Ctrl+x to Save & Exit from nano Editor :)
